Case Summary: CMP(MD) 6001/2026 The Madurai Bench of Madras High Court (05.06.2026) adjourned the civil revision petition filed by M. Mahalingam against the 1st Additional District Court, Trichy's order. The court directed the lower court to transmit all execution petition records by 11.06.2026 and ordered status quo maintenance on the property. The decree holder must deposit valued goods (Rs. 5,29,000/-) with the court by 08.06.2026, and the matter is posted for further hearing on 11.06.2026.
